Output ec4c6d287b4cf9bc01a9e90646231c838d4567b0e09b2ea6ff16f76e48f2e4ed:1

value
3991115
script pubkey
OP_0 OP_PUSHBYTES_20 6655bdecd76a7404ffe34a1c65a83cebedf0770d
address
bc1qve2mmmxhdf6qfllrfgwxt2pua0klqacdasg3hk
transaction
ec4c6d287b4cf9bc01a9e90646231c838d4567b0e09b2ea6ff16f76e48f2e4ed
confirmations
166786
spent
true